Reliance to
invest $7.5 Bn for two microchip units
The Mukesh Ambani-led Reliance Industries, a giant
in areas ranging from oil exploration to petrochemicals, proposes to invest $7.5 billion over the
next 10 years to set up two microchip manufacturing units in India.

Railways target 1,100 MT freight traffic for 11th Plan
Indian Railways have set a target of carrying 850
million tonnes (MT) of freight in 2008-09, going up to 1,100 MT by the last year of the Eleventh
Five Year Plan, 2011-2012.

M&M, ICICI Venture consortium to acquire Italian firm
Auto major Mahindra & Mahindra in collaboration
with ICICI Venture Funds Management Ltd has decided to acquire 100 percent stake in leading
Italian gear manufacturer Metalcastello Spa.
